> > The fill-column indicator is not displayed in lines that extend poast
> > the fill-column, so this problem doesn't happen there, or at least not
> > in the popular scenarios (including both scenarios described in this
> > thread).
>
> At least for the *vc-log* case, the thin-separator-line is actually an
> empty line
This is a misunderstanding of what "extend" means, in this context.
It means we have glyphs there. And we must, when the background is
not the default one.
